Transaction 37fa7303f60accaaf3988c433b5fda604b81cfc1cbc625982a555cba8ee8c064
1 Input
1 Output
-
37fa7303f60accaaf3988c433b5fda604b81cfc1cbc625982a555cba8ee8c064:0
- value
- 29377
- script pubkey
- OP_0 OP_PUSHBYTES_32 df7375ec201e16f7c79d52be03eda1c133b07325cf8b844de7959bef9dce099b
- address
- bc1qmaehtmpqrct003ua22lq8mdpcyemque9e79cgn08jkd7l8wwpxdsh8d2fr